Kerry, Abbas Agree on 5-Day Ceasefire

A source within the Palestinian Authority announced on Thursday that US Secretary of State John Kerry and Palestinian Authority Chairman Mahmoud Abbas agreed during a meeting on Wednesday in Ramallah on a proposal for an immediate five-day ceasefire, during which negotiations would take place between Israel and the PA.

 

According to the source, Kerry promised Abbas that America would support him in his quest to remove the siege over Gaza.
